A Brief History of Yorkshire Terriers
Yorkies came from the early 19th century in England, particularly [Yorkshire Terrier Welpe](https://fakenews.win/wiki/10_Facts_About_Mini_Yorkie_Puppies_That_Can_Instantly_Put_You_In_A_Good_Mood), where they were initially bred to catch rats in clothes mills and mines. The type's unique qualities were established through a mix of little terriers, including the now-extinct Waterside Terrier and the Skye Terrier. For many years, Yorkies transitioned from working dogs to beloved companions and show dogs, showcasing their flexibility and charm.

Yorkies are lap dogs, normally weighing in between 4 to 7 pounds and standing about 8 to 9 inches tall at the shoulder. They are best understood for their long, streaming coats that can vary from blue and tan to golden. Their compact size and glamorous fur make them perfect for apartment living, however prospective owners must know their grooming requirements and exercise requirements.

Yorkies are known for their outgoing, spirited character. Though small, they possess a brave and positive temperament, typically asserting themselves as the protectors of their household. They are caring and devoted to their families, making them wonderful companions. Nevertheless, their strong-willed nature may need consistent training and socializing from a young age to avoid behavioral problems.

Grooming Needs
Yorkies need regular grooming to maintain their gorgeous coats and avoid matting. It is advised to brush their fur at least 2 to 3 times a week.

Despite their small size, Yorkies are active and require daily workout. Brief strolls, playtime, and mental stimulation through toys are vital for keeping them healthy and happy.

Are Yorkies good with kids?
Yorkies can be good with children, however they are delicate and may not endure misuse. It's vital to teach children how to interact carefully with them.
2. How often should I take my Yorkie to the vet?
Routine veterinary sees are essential. Typically, Yorkies need to see a veterinarian a minimum of once a year for wellness check-ups and vaccinations.
3. Do Yorkies shed a lot?
Yorkies are considered low-shedding due to the fact that they have a coat similar to human hair. Regular grooming helps to lessen loose hair in the environment.
4. Can Yorkies be left alone?
While Yorkies can tolerate being alone for a couple of hours, they thrive on friendship. Long periods without interaction can result in separation stress and anxiety.
5. What is the average life expectancy of a Yorkie?
The typical life expectancy of a Yorkshire Terrier is around 12 to 15 years, however with appropriate care, some can live even longer.
